Coins, Stamps and Collectibles: 1948 Olympic Games Stamps

thedigitalphilatelist 25/07/2021

Coins, Stamps and Collectibles looks at the four 1948 Olympic Games Commemorative Stamps celebrating the London Games 72 years ago. King George VI appears on all four stamps and we discuss their designers.

Philatelic Specialists Society of Canada: 14th UPU Congress Ottawa, Canada 1957

thedigitalphilatelist 24/07/2021

The 1957 UPU Congress was only the second time that it had been held in North America, the first being the Washington Congress, sixty years prior in 1897. The congress was held in the Parliament Buildings and lasted 7 weeks from Aug 14 to Oct 3, 1957. Three hundred and…
